 Hi,
 
 The problem occurs after some number of calls to sockout.  Here is
 an example done on my machine.  The output of uname -a is:
 
 FreeBSD mongo.pbspro.com 4.3-STABLE FreeBSD 4.3-STABLE #3: Thu May 10 16:27:47 PDT 2001     proett@mongo.pbspro.com:/usr/src/sys/compile/BONGO i386 
 
 --- window 1 ---
 mongo# ./sockout 4711
 got port 1023
 mongo# ./sockout 4711
 got port 1023
 mongo# ./sockout 4711
 got port 1023
 connect: Operation timed out
 mongo# 
 --- window 1 ---
 
 --- window 2 ---
 proett 1> ./sockin 4711
 timeout
 ./sockin: 127.0.0.1
 close
 ./sockin: 127.0.0.1
 close
 timeout
 timeout
 timeout
 ...
 ^C
 proett 2> 
 --- window 2 ---
 
 The third call to sockout was not detected by sockin which continued
 to periodicaly timeout until I hit ^C.  I ran netstat while it was in
 this state and got:
 
 tcp4       0      0  localhost.1023         localhost.4711         SYN_SENT
 tcp4       0      0  localhost.4711         localhost.1023         TIME_WAIT
